WebSep 29, 2015 · Details. SSH establishes a secure channel, at which point the server provides its public key fingerprint. This is all fully encrypted. During the key exchange ( RFC4253) the server signs several pieces of data with its private key for the client to authenticate. This proves that the server has the private key for which the client has the …

WebAug 1, 2024 · If, later, the hostname or IP address you connect to provides you a different fingerprint, ssh will again show you a warning that the fingerprint has changed. This could be because the communication is being intercepted, the server has changed (e.g. rebuilt a VM, using the same IP or hostname for an entirely new server, etc). WebNov 28, 2024 · The server has removed an old ciphersuite which it doesn't want to support anymore. The server IP has changed and you have "CheckHostIP yes" in your config (default on many systems). You have connected to the same server using a different hostname (think about something like gitlab) since the default ciphersuites have changed. WebFeb 8, 2024 · 4. Restart Your Phone.
